计算机应用软件是计算机系统中使用的各种程序,它们可以帮助用户更有效地完成各种任务。以下是一些常见的计算机应用软件:
1. 办公软件:Microsoft Office套件包括Word、Excel、PowerPoint、Outlook等,这些软件广泛用于个人和企业的文档处理、数据分析和通信。
2. 图像处理软件:Adobe Photoshop、GIMP、Paint.NET等,用于图像编辑、设计和照片修复。
3. 视频编辑软件:Adobe Premiere Pro、Final Cut Pro、DaVinci Resolve等,用于视频剪辑、特效制作和后期合成。
4. 音频编辑软件:Audacity、FL Studio、Ableton Live等,用于音频录制、编辑和混音。
5. 编程开发工具:Visual Studio、Eclipse、PyCharm等,用于软件开发、调试和版本控制。
6. 数据可视化工具:Tableau、QlikView、Microsoft Power BI等,用于创建交互式数据报告和仪表板。
7. 数据库管理工具:MySQL Workbench、Oracle SQL Developer、SQL Server Management Studio等,用于数据库设计、管理和操作。
8. 网络管理工具:PuTTY、NetBeans、Apache HTTP Server等,用于远程连接、配置和管理网络服务。
9. 系统监控与优化工具:Windows Task Manager、Performance Monitor、NMap等,用于系统性能监控、诊断和网络扫描。
10. 云服务管理工具:AWS CLI、Azure CLI、Google Cloud SDK等,用于管理和部署云计算资源。
11. 网络安全工具:Wireshark、Nmap、SonarQube等,用于网络嗅探、端口扫描和代码质量检查。
12. 自动化测试工具:Selenium、JMeter、LoadRunner等,用于网页和应用的自动化测试。
13. 数据仓库工具:Hadoop HDFS、Hive、Spark等,用于大规模数据的存储、查询和分析。
14. 移动开发工具:Xcode、Android Studio、Github Actions等,用于iOS和Android应用的开发和部署。
15. 虚拟化与容器技术工具:VMware Workstation、VirtualBox、Docker等,用于虚拟机管理和容器化部署。
16. 游戏开发工具:Unity、Unreal Engine、Godot等,用于游戏引擎的开发和游戏项目的构建。
17. 机器学习与人工智能工具:TensorFlow、Keras、PyTorch等,用于机器学习算法的开发和模型训练。
18. 物联网(IoT)开发工具:MQTT、CoAP、Zigbee等,用于设备间的通信和数据交换。
19. 虚拟现实(VR)与增强现实(AR)工具:Unity、Unreal Engine、ARKit等,用于VR/AR内容的创建和集成。
20. 区块链开发工具:Hyperledger Fabric、Ethereum、Bitcoin等,用于区块链技术的开发和实现。
这些应用软件涵盖了从基础办公到高级开发的各个层面,满足了不同用户群体的需求。随着技术的不断发展,新的应用软件也在不断涌现,为人们提供了更多便利和创新的解决方案。